In a suit for specific performance of an agreement of sale of immovable property, can we seek for the relief of temporary injunction, restraining the defendant not to alienate the schedule proeprty during the pendency of the suit proceedings , without seeking for the relief of permanent injunction in the main suit. Please give for/against Judgments
1.THERE ARE SC.CITATIONS REGARDING THE FACT THAT YOU SHOULD HAVE PRAYER FOR PERMANENT INJUNCTION IN YOUR MAIN APPLICATION AND UNLESS YOU HAVE SAID PRAYER YOU CAN NOT SEEK TEMPORARY INJUNCTION.
BUT KINDLY NOTE THAT DIFFERENT CITATIONS ARE AVAILABLE.YOU MAY STRONGLY ARGUE ON THE POINT OF IRREPAIRABLE LOSS CAUSE TO YOU IN CASE TEMP.INJUNCTION IS NOT GRANTED THEN COURT MAY CONSIDER THE SAME.PLEASE NOTE.
